Job Summary
Supporting the Data Effects Cell (DEC) remotely in Eastern Europe, the full-time OSINT Analyst with TS Clearance will systematically collect, analyze, and produce actionable intelligence from open source data to inform U.S. Army Special Operations planning and decision-making.
Key responsibilities:
- Conduct systematic collection and exploitation of open source intelligence across various platforms to develop comprehensive profiles relevant to USASOC missions
- Produce finished analytical products, including threat assessments and network analyses, by fusing open source data with classified information
- Monitor social media and geospatial data to identify emerging threats and support operational analysis for Special Operations units
Required qualifications:
- Bachelor's degree in a relevant field or equivalent military education and experience
- 4+ years of experience as an OSINT analyst or all-source analyst within a DoD, IC, or defense contracting environment
- Proficiency with OSINT collection tools and frameworks, such as Maltego and Palantir
- Hands-on experience with social media exploitation and open source network analysis techniques
- Active TS or TS/SCI security clearance required
